Description by the author

This hiking classic is organized annually in the first weekend of May by wsvNOAD from Bocholtz. It is one of the most difficult walking routes in the Netherlands, among other things, because of the many hills with sometimes considerable increases. The classic is largely run in groups at an average speed of 6.5 km per hour. The last 15 km is free course and is marked.

The route is a walking route but despite that it sometimes runs on public roads or bicycle paths. There are also areas that are only accessible to pedestrians. There are plenty of opportunities to take a break but also to stay overnight if the route is run individually.

The car route and / or motorcycle and bicycle route are different from this walking route, which is very easy to do at your own pace, where the opportunity to enjoy nature is of course abundant. You can determine the starting point for this circular walk.
